Output 40f83f8e61466b3d357fa5ca5df0177779bcecba0d73bb687b320ff8a8ec518b:0

value
42495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8cc3eaf2e5b86b2e6f9d284f6e045e04f93d936 OP_EQUAL
address
3MTLZAHGHabSSUzV8wVFEhtoymhKDKK8TA
transaction
40f83f8e61466b3d357fa5ca5df0177779bcecba0d73bb687b320ff8a8ec518b
spent
true